- The distance between Luling, Tx, Usa and Muscat , Oman is approximately 13,558 km or 8,425 mi.
- To reach Luling, Tx in this distance one would set out from Muscat bearing 335.3°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Luling, Tx bearing 206.1° or SSW .
- Luling, Tx has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Muscat has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- The mean annual temperature is 8.8 °C (15.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.8 °C (10.4°F) more in Luling, Tx.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 796.4 mm (31.4 in) more which is equivalent to 796.4 l/m² (19.55 US gal/ft²) or 7,964,000 l/ha (851,404 US gal/ac) more. About 9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6° lower in Luling, Tx than in Muscat .
